South Benfleet is a neighbourhood in Essex with a population of 13,026. The median house price is £397,500, with 534 sales in the past 12 months and prices rising 9.6 percent over five years.

Detached homes sell for a median of £540,000, semi-detached properties for £385,000, and flats for £232,500. The median age is 46.0 years. Owner-occupied homes account for 85.4 percent of households, with 45.8 percent owned outright. Air quality is favourable: nitrogen dioxide levels are low at 9.6 micrograms per cubic metre, though particulate matter is moderate at 7.2. Flood risk is minimal, affecting 2.7 percent of the area. About 75 percent of neighbourhoods in England are more deprived. Broadband connectivity is strong, with 98.8 percent superfast coverage. Planning is managed by Castle Point Borough Council, with 43.6 percent of the area in green belt and two conservation areas.
